Digital WorldUnited States of AmericaWhy Meta deleted 10 Million Facebook accounts 02:49This browser does not support the video element.Digital WorldUnited States of AmericaRoger Ditter07/17/2025July 17, 2025Meta’s AI has launched a major social media cleanup. Will it actually improve your online experience? Copy linkAdvertisement